| Comments: |
Да ну. Синдром дефицита внимания -- страшно распространенная
штука, не меньше, чем у половины пользователей это есть.
Это не есть годное объяснение: мало ли что можно делать для
привлечения внимания, почему именно Путин.
А почему нет-то. То есть так вопрос можно ставить по по поводу какого угодно объекта: почему X а не Y. Я правда не говорю что именно дефицит внимания всему там причиной, там по-моему гораздо более серьезное расстройство личности.
Так если конструктивное объяснение, и система хоть как-то детерминированная, то нет. В смысле, нельзя будет так вопрос поставить.
>Синдром дефицита внимания А я думал, это когда внимание рассеянное, потому и спиды прописывают, чтобы человек сосредоточиться мог.
| From: | (Anonymous) |
| Date: | May 25th, 2012 - 01:51 pm |
|---|
| | | (Link) |
|
Потому что путина клянут те, чьего внимания он ищет. Он бы, может, и рад был бы срывать покровы с языков программирования, например, да только его целевая аудитория к ним равнодушна.
Я бы не была так уверена. Среди моих ближайших друзей, думаю, больше тех, кого можно шокировать, например, выбором языка Perl для решения прикладной задачи, чем любой сентенцией о Путине и его власти. А я мало чего понимаю в программировании. В случае Куздры - - -
| From: | spqr |
| Date: | May 25th, 2012 - 05:00 pm |
|---|
| | | (Link) |
|
Взялся человек о функциональных языках писать и лисп критиковать, да и затих. Сидим вот, ждём продолжения.
| From: | potan |
| Date: | May 25th, 2012 - 05:32 pm |
|---|
| | | (Link) |
|
Зачем продолжение? И так все ясно - Common Lisp отстой, Haskell рулит, но для практических целей и OCaml сойдет. А с судьбами Путина и России еще не все ясно...
| From: | spqr |
| Date: | May 25th, 2012 - 08:57 pm |
|---|
| | | (Link) |
|
Понимаю, что мнение авторитетное и от человека пользующегося, но хотелось бы поразвёрнутей. Путены приходят и уходят, а лисп остаётся.
Haskell - тоже отстой. Более того - классический отстой. Ошибка, которую уже полвека делают. "Теперь и в FP"
![[User Picture]](http://lj.rossia.org/userpic/176603/5) | | From: | yushi |
| Date: | May 25th, 2012 - 11:02 pm |
|---|
| | | (Link) |
|
А чем он плох-то? Раздут?
Я тут сделал вялую попытку переползти со Scheme на OCaml, но на свою беду заглянул в учебник Харпера по SML, и это меня жутко демотивировало. OCaml на фоне SML натуральный же C++, по крайней мере, на первый взгляд. А все компиляторы SML какие-то больные, два или три относительно живых из попавшихся мне вообще были намертво привязаны к x86-32.
Мне в Хаскеле абсолютно не устраивает реализация вычислений с плавающей точкой. Она фундаментально сломана - на уровне прелюдии и стандарта языка. Что очень жаль, вообще-то.
| From: | potan |
| Date: | May 26th, 2012 - 08:23 am |
|---|
| | | (Link) |
|
? Там не очень удобна необходимость явного преобразования из целых, но особых кривостей я не вижу. Я как то на нем обработку изображений отлаживал - они представлялись как списки списков плавающих чисел. Вполне удобно было.
Арифметика с плавающей точкой в Хаскеле не соответствует стандарту IEEE754, то есть для чего-то важного (типа расчёта мостов) её использовать просто нельзя. Например, Хаскель считает 4 действия арифметики "чистыми" операциями, а они на самом деле не таковы - результат зависит от флагов округления, и выполнение операций может изменять состояние других флагов процессора. Ну и плюс всякие приятные мелочи, вроде неправильной обработки специальных значений (NaN). Вот например, на этот ололо-баг я сам наткнулся.
| From: | potan |
| Date: | May 26th, 2012 - 08:11 am |
|---|
| | | (Link) |
|
Я сталкивался с вполне промышленным кодом на SML. Последнее такое столкновение - на нем написан компилятор OpenModelica.
![[User Picture]](http://lj.rossia.org/userpic/176603/5) | | From: | yushi |
| Date: | May 26th, 2012 - 09:56 am |
|---|
| | | (Link) |
|
А что за компилятор SML они используют?
| From: | potan |
| Date: | May 26th, 2012 - 08:27 pm |
|---|
| | | (Link) |
|
SML/NJ Есть поримание, как собраться PolyML, но у меня не получилось.
| From: | eacher |
| Date: | May 26th, 2012 - 10:06 am |
|---|
| | off top | (Link) |
|
<<< Ошибка, которую уже полвека делают.
Please, please tell more. Really, no kidding - very interesting. Especially in your interpretation.
![[User Picture]](http://lj.rossia.org/userpic/172165/60) | | From: | kouzdra |
| Date: | May 26th, 2012 - 10:19 am |
|---|
| | Re: off top | (Link) |
|
Haskell - это громоздкое и тормозное угробище (сейчас это несколько замаскировалось ростом производительности компов, но когда я с ним столкнулся - был реальный тормоз - и компилятор и исполняемый код).
Причем никакой необходимости в этом нет - Clean скажем практически как язык аналог - но и программы и компилятор там быстрые.
Это раз.
Два - Хаскелль - типичная жертва попыток засунуть в один язык все - как и PL/I, (отчасти) Algol-68, С++ (к которому он кстати по системе типов довольно близок - куда ближе, чем кажется).
Что в результате этих попыток получается - давно известно. Равно как и известная польза разумного самоограничения в вопросах языкового дизайна. Но мыши плачут и продолжают грызть кактус.
| From: | eacher |
| Date: | May 26th, 2012 - 01:03 pm |
|---|
| | Re: off top | (Link) |
|
Thank you.
I remember that you wrote some tings in haskell - just for fun (I myself write 'helo world' all the time by the way). So it is not for flaming or some sort of checking, believe me. But... <<< Хаскелль - типичная жертва попыток засунуть в один язык все все - what's it about? I understand that it's not abt 'monads', and not about the 'type system', but in this case - what else and why 'засунуть'?
tnx agn
< да только его целевая аудитория к ним равнодушна.
vot ne nado govorit' za vseh - ok? ya, k primeru - ne ravnodushen.
| From: | (Anonymous) |
| Date: | May 26th, 2012 - 09:28 pm |
|---|
| | | (Link) |
|
он ищет вашего внимания? | |